The general practice category in KZN carries two visibility problems at once. The first is familiar from the professional silence pattern documented in dentistry: clinically reputable, long-established practices that have accumulated no meaningful digital presence and hold no map pack positions for the queries patients actually use. The second is specific to general practice, and it goes deeper. Many independent GPs in KZN do not practise in standalone facilities. They practise within hospital group buildings, large medical centres, and multi-practice complexes whose institutional brands are themselves well established in search. The GP practice within the building is invisible. The building is findable. We call this the institutional shadow.

The institutional shadow defined

A GP who has practised for 20 years within a well-known medical centre occupies a particular position in search. The medical centre brand has a Google Business Profile, a website, a review history, and an address that is consistent across the web. When a patient searches “GP Umhlanga” or “family doctor Durban North,” the institution appears. The individual practice does not, because the individual practice has no separate digital identity that search can resolve to a rankable entity.

This is not a problem of quality or relevance. The GP may be excellent. Their patient base may be loyal and long-standing. But loyalty from existing patients is built through clinical relationship, not through search. A new patient with no referral source does not know the practitioner exists. They see the medical centre. If the institution’s website or GBP lists the GPs who practise there, the individual becomes a line item on the institution’s page, not a practitioner with their own search presence.

The institutional shadow is not the result of deliberate suppression. It is structural. The medical centre has built its own brand over time. The GP, operating within that building, has not built theirs alongside it.

The highest-value search scenario in general practice is the new resident looking for a regular GP in an unfamiliar suburb. A household that has moved into the area has no GP, no referral source, and no existing relationship with a practice nearby. They search Google. The query is typically something like “GP near me,” “family doctor [suburb name],” or “GP taking new patients [area].”

The practice that appears in the map pack for that suburb receives the enquiry. The practices that do not, regardless of how long they have been operating within walking distance, receive nothing from that query.

Once registered, this patient is typically a multi-year patient. A household may register several family members. The lifetime value of the new-resident patient acquired through search is considerable. And the competition for that patient, in our monitoring of GP-relevant queries across KZN suburbs, is less intense than in most other categories. Map pack positions are frequently held by whichever practice has completed its GBP and accumulated a modest review count. The threshold is accessible. The large majority of independent practices in our dataset have not attempted to reach it.

The GBP situation

Independent GP practices in KZN frequently have unclaimed or incomplete Google Business Profiles. Where a profile exists, it commonly lists the medical centre address and the building’s central phone number rather than the direct contact details for the individual practice. A patient who attempts to book through those details may reach a reception desk that does not manage the GP’s diary, or may not reach the practice at all.

Category selection on the GBP matters more than most practice managers recognise. “General practitioner,” “Medical clinic,” and “Medical center” are distinct categories in Google’s classification system. Each triggers a different set of queries. A GP practice categorised as a medical center by a default setup, or one whose profile was configured by building management rather than the practice itself, may be appearing for queries that do not match what the practice offers, while missing the queries it should actually rank for.

These are correctable configurations. They require access to the GBP account and an understanding of what the category selections determine. Most practices in our dataset have never addressed them.

Healthcare-specific schema

Google provides specific schema markup types for healthcare entities: MedicalClinic and Physician, among others. These types signal to Google what the entity is, what it treats, and what geographic area it serves. They are the structured-data equivalent of telling search exactly how to classify the practice.

In our monitoring dataset for the general practice category in KZN, healthcare-specific structured data is present on virtually none of the independent practice websites. The schema types exist for precisely this purpose. They are not being used.

The reason this matters is shifting. As AI assistants handle a growing proportion of healthcare-adjacent queries, the absence of structured data means a practice cannot be accurately represented in an AI response. A patient who asks an AI assistant to suggest a GP in their suburb receives a response generated from what the AI can parse. A practice whose website identifies its clinical focus, location, practitioner credentials, and service scope through schema markup is more likely to be represented accurately in that response than one whose information sits in unstructured body text with no signal the AI can interpret with precision.

The appointment availability content gap

There is one category of information that appears on almost no GP practice website in our dataset, despite being the primary decision factor for a patient choosing between two practices they found in the map pack: appointment availability.

A patient who finds two nearby practices through search will often contact whichever one first gives them a clear signal about how to book and whether the practice is accepting new patients. That information is almost never published online. It requires a phone call to extract. For a patient whose entire search process has been digital, that friction carries weight.

A practice that publishes whether it accepts new patients, what the booking process involves, and what the usual wait for a non-urgent appointment looks like, is providing the content its patients are actively looking for. That content also creates a genuine competitive advantage in search: a page that addresses appointment availability for a specific suburb is addressing something no other practice website in the area is addressing. It fills a real content gap against a real patient need, and it does so at a point in the patient’s decision process when the decision has not yet been made.
